2-5. Setting Smart Functions
Set Smart Functions for images from each camera.
Procedure

2.
Select the network camera to configure at “Camera Name”.
Attention
•
For 1 Screen or 4 Screens layouts the settings of each network camera are applied. For 8 Screens, 9
Screens or 16 Screens layouts, the “17_Full Screen” settings are applied to all screens and the settings of
each network camera are not applied.
3. Configure the items.
Item
Detail
Setting range
Mode
Select the display mode to apply to the images of
the selected network camera.
Set to “DAY” to apply a mode suitable for general
images.
Set to “NIGHT” to apply a mode suitable for
monochrome images such as images taken at
night.
DAY/NIGHT/Off
Smart Resolution
Adjusts the perceived resolution of the images
so that the blurs are reduced and images are
displayed vividly and clearly.
1 to 5/Off
Smart Insight
Makes dark areas of images visible by analyzing
the image and correcting the brightness for each
pixel. It is effective for images with dark area that
are less visible and for bright environments.
1 to 5/Off
Noise Reduction
Reduces the amount of block noise that occurs due
to video compression.
On/Off
4. Select “Apply”.
The setting complete screen is displayed. Select “OK”.
